a rectangular solid has sides of 7cm, 9cm, and 11 cm. what is the surface area?

Respuesta :

arpitch arpitch
  • 01-03-2019

Answer: 478

Step-by-step explanation:

Surface area = 2(lb+bh+hl)

= 2(7*9+9*11+11*7)

= 2(63+99+77)

= 2(239)

= 478 square units
